## Releases

Heads up, plugin folks: the Sheetfall CSV Import Wizard now versions its plugin API separately from the core app. Pin your plugins to the API version, not the app release, and you'll avoid most breakage. We publish signed plugin manifests with every release so the wizard can verify your package at install time. Manifests are signed with the following key:

rollout seal: bky4_DFM9

# Break-Glass: Invrec Reconciliation Job

The Invrec job reconciles warehouse counts nightly on the Maplight cluster. If it stalls mid-run, on-call may invoke break-glass to restart it with elevated rights. This bypasses the normal approval queue, so log the action in the sync notes afterward. Break-glass requires unsealing the Invrec ops vault, and the recovery passphrase for that vault is recorded below.

recovery phrase for fajep-yaweg: gilath-sorox-wenius-rusdor-keliel-zorius

- [ ] **Step 7: Breaker override escrow.** After sealing the signing keys for the Tallgrove upstream API circuit breaker, confirm the support team can force the breaker open during a full outage. The override bundle lives in the sealed escrow drawer and is useless without its unlock phrase. Two ceremony witnesses must initial this step before proceeding. The escrow bundle is decrypted with the recovery passphrase that follows.

vault phrase of kahip-kahop = holath-quenmir

Ticket #88: Badge system migration, night-shift notice. Over the weekend, Fenwick Row is moving from the old Keystone readers to the new Ardale panels. Night staff should expect the lift lobby readers to be offline between 01:00 and 04:00 on Saturday. During this window, use the stairwell doors only, and log every entry in the paper register at the guard desk. Legacy badges will stop working once the cutover completes. Until your replacement badge arrives, the night crew should use the interim code below.

door code, yageg-yagap: bdg-DNN-9

Ticket FD-HUNT-211: staging box for the Quillbore collector was launched with the wrong env profile, so descriptor auditing ran against prod sockets. Fixed profile selection; leaked FDs traced to an unrotated log pipe. Remaining action: the audit agent still needs its reporting credential in the staging env file. Append it on the line immediately after this note.

env line for fafof-fahag: LEDGER_TOKEN5=f8790